Output 84f8b2e5b4f65f82f26fb0b2c87f88c5a499ca35a7ccc166026f4afb1e923e28: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34671ea5cdc381257db0e0ebcfb1de7f9efa91d4 OP_EQUAL
address
36U6bQJJxHVMw5wtMhExCm8Bx8Vvo3sCKr
transaction
84f8b2e5b4f65f82f26fb0b2c87f88c5a499ca35a7ccc166026f4afb1e923e28
confirmations
133568
spent
true